# Catalogue import for the Thistledown Library system — welcome aboard!
# This job pulls MARC records nightly from the Bramblewick aggregator and
# upserts them into our catalogue DB. If imports stall, check the cursor
# file before rerunning, or you'll get duplicates. Tweak BATCH_SIZE only
# with sign-off. The aggregator credential the importer authenticates with
# appears on the next line.

vault entry, kahip-fahog: RELAY_SECRET20=6a2c791de808f35c3b55

**Title:** Fleet fuel-usage report exposes vehicle rows outside requester's depot

The Harrowfield fleet dashboard's monthly fuel report ignores depot scoping when exported as CSV, returning all vehicles. The web view filters correctly, so the gap is in the export path's query builder. No evidence of exploitation yet. The affected export service build is recorded below.

pipeline stamp: htk31_f769b577b3028a4e9958e5bb8d1259a

**Ceremony Item 12 — Export Retry Credentials (Plugin Authors)**

During the key ceremony, confirm that the Ferrowick export service's retry queue can be re-authenticated by external plugins after a key rotation. Trigger one deliberately failed export, observe the retry scheduler pick it up, and verify the new signing key is honored on the second attempt. If the retry daemon prompts for emergency re-authentication at this stage, plugin authors should supply the recovery passphrase noted immediately below.

unlock words, hahip-yagef: zorok-novmir-zorix-silax

Handover note — master copies for Brindlewood Print Shop

Priya, taking over from me today. The three master copies for the Halloran account brochure are in the red folio on my desk, each sheet interleaved with acid-free tissue — please keep them flat and away from the window. These are the only approved originals; the proofs in the drawer are outdated and must not go out. Brindlewood's courier is booked for 14:00 and will present a collection slip. Once you've verified the slip against the job number, give the courier this instruction:

handover note for kagep-kagup: the holok holdor courier leaves the rusix sorox fenwyn ledger at gate 3590 under passcode 092644